A young Bellmont team started the season with an invigorating win over rival Norwell by two strokes, while also beating Wayne, with a score of 173 at Brookwood Tuesday.
The top returning player for the team, Owen Minnick, led the way with medalist honors with his round of 40. Minnick made birdie on the Par-5 13th hole for the Braves.
“Pretty good first round we thought,” noted assistant coach Mike Macke. “Only Owen is returning from last year. Brady (Malone) is the only senior this year. We think Ben Binegar will be a solid number 2 for us. Brady should give us decent consistency in low to mid 40’s. After that, we need a couple of guys to step up and provide a good fourth score.”
Norwell finished with a score of 175 and the Knights were not officially playing the Braves, but the two rivals still played the same holes on the same night.
The Braves are set to play at Noble Hawk Thursday.
